Responsibilities:

  • Guide internal customers on how to configure and deploy PaaS infrastructure consisting of identity and access management, network architecture, application security, logging, monitoring, deployment and more
  • Collaborate with Software Architects on how to best design their cloud applications for optimal scaling including content caching, compute optimizations, continuous integration and delivery pipeline, load balancer setup, and more
  • Interface with internal and external customers to deploy solutions and deliver workshops to educate and empower them
  • Work closely with Project Management to build and constantly drive excellence in our solutions
  • Guide engineering teams in evolving Cloud technologies
  • Work with Critical internal and external Platform Consumers.
  • Support successful implementation of Application PaaS in the Cloud through architecture guidance, best practices, data migration, implementation, troubleshooting, monitoring, and more.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Systems Engineering, or a related Science, Engineering or Mathematics field; Also requires 10+ years of job-related experience, or a Masters degree plus 8 years of job-related experience
  • TS/SCI security clearance is preferred at time of hire; must be able to obtain a TS/SCI clearance within a reasonable amount of time from date of hire.
  • Experience working with, or are familiar with the differences between, public (AWS, Azure), private (RHOSP, VIO), and mixed cloud environments
  • Container technologies such as Docker, or Kubernetes
  • Deployment of continuous integration and continuous deployment technologies such as GitLab, Jenkins, Puppet, or Chef
  • Experience maintaining production-grade applications in virtualized environments (cloud computing platforms and services) using automation
  • Creation of pipelines, Ansible Playbooks, and/or Terraform configurations to automate administrative actions from resource creation to service configuration
  • Effective communication and attention to detail
  • IT security practices including encryption, certificates, key management, patch management, STIG, RMF, or security hardening, and auditing
  • Installation of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S) technologies such as Amazon Web Services, OpenStack, RHOSP, or VIO
  • Management of Cloud Resources in Amazon Web Services, and/or Azure
  • Platform as a Service (PaaS) technologies such as Kubernetes, Rancher, or OpenShift
  • Cloud automation tooling such as Ansible, Terraform, Terragrunt, or Packer
  • Open source server, messaging, load balancing, and database software (such as RabbitMQ, Redis, Elasticsearch)
  • Scalable networking technologies such as Load Balancers (NGINX)/Firewalls and web standards (REST APIs, web security mechanisms)
